About Bordeaux (BOD)

A paramount port city located on the south-western side of France, Bordeaux is also referred locally as the ‘French Sleeping Beauty’. It is also known as ‘La perle d'Aquitaine’, ‘La Belle Endormie’ related to the old centre which was covered with black walls due to pollution. You can easily find many of its most beautiful Neo-classical buildings which have been entirely restored. There are a number of beautiful spacious boulevards which have now become completely pedestrianised. Tourism is booming in Bordeaux as a large number of travellers like to visit the port city from every corner of the world. The city features a number of tourist information offices where you can get proper information about the city and its main attractions. You can find some of the main tourism bureaus along the Rue de Argentiers, Cours du 30 Juillet, near to the banks on the Cours de l'Intendence and so on. Croiseur Colbert, Palais de la Bourse, Palais Rohan (Rohan Palace), Grand Theatre, Zoo de Bordeaux Pessac (Bordeaux Zoo) and so on are some of the major tourist attractions that lure large number of travellers from all across the world. It is an important historical city which houses a large number of eye-catching and unusual historic and religious monuments. Some of the attractive landmarks like the Pont St. Pierre and the tour Pey-Berland offer panoramic views of Bordeaux. The entire city is well-linked with transport services and you can easily move from one place to another. About Dublin (DUB)

Situated at the mouth of the River Liffey, Dublin is the capital and the most populous city of Ireland. The word 'Dublin' means ‘town of the huddled ford’. Enveloped by a low mountain range to the south and bordered by the low farmland to the north and west, Dublin is a beautiful city which experiences a maritime climate with non extreme temperatures. Its mild winters and cool summers please everyone and act like an open invitation to tourists coming to visit the city from each corner of the world. The entire Dublin is dotted with beautiful landmarks and monuments with imposing structures. The oldest is Dublin Castle which was constructed shortly after Norman Invasion of Ireland in 1169. The newest structure is Spire of Dublin; this stainless steel conical spire is located on O'Connell Street. Other important and attractive landmarks are Ha'penny Bridge, Mansion House, Ann Livia Monument, Molly Malone Statue, Christ Church Cathedral, The Custom House, Poolbeg Towers and Aras an Uachtarain. Dublin is a nature's paradise; the city comprises several parks which are naturally irrigated by rivers. Few famous parks are Phonenix Park, Herbert Park and St Stephen's Green. For shopaholics it is important to know that Grafton Street and Henry Street are the main shopping streets in Dublin's city center. It's a world renowned truth that Ireland is home to art and music of which Dublin is the main source. Dublin owns the world famous literary history. You can find a lot of literary theaters, most famous among which are Gaiety, Abbey, Olympia, Gate and Grand Canal. Apart from this, Dublin has the most vibrant, youthful and unpretending nightlife. With gala of music and dance all around, the city grooves on its own beats.
